Output 63bbd0fe003b1aaf87914dc4dbdc2342a158925a17ab09bb976327c7e8a08fa8:0

value
133444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d4209d3bcd839e3d9a7f132accf04588f0aa19 OP_EQUAL
address
3NH65aLrWpx3EBe93Pnq5GuzZx12Nw7XGP
transaction
63bbd0fe003b1aaf87914dc4dbdc2342a158925a17ab09bb976327c7e8a08fa8
confirmations
268856
spent
true